What are the welding procedures for Alloy Steel A234 WP22 buttweld pipe fittings?
The most common approach used to weld Alloy Steel A234 WP22 buttweld pipe fittings is gas tungsten arc welding (GTAW), also known as inert tungsten gas (TIG) welding. Prior to welding, it is crucial to make sure the fittings’ surfaces are spotless and devoid of any impurities that could lead to flaws or weaken the weld. To prevent overheating and guarantee appropriate penetration, welding factors including heat input and interpass temperature must also be closely controlled. To ensure the integrity and strength of the weld connection, proper post-weld heat treatment is also required.

Grade | C | Mn | Si | S | P | Cr | Mo |
A234 WP5 | ≤0.15 | ≤0.6 | ≤0.5 | ≤0.04 | ≤0.03 | 4-6 | 0.44-0.65 |
Grade | Tensile Strength (Mpa) | Yield Strength (Mpa) | Elongation % |
A234 WP5 | 415 – 585 | ≥205 | ≥20 |
